Output e9081d9b64e000730b81dbebcaa40ee89f0cfeb7500992055d1102542f071b32:0

value
531394289
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f412ace8120c90ddd0d051421222411ef79f298 OP_EQUAL
address
3BqGzjYTE6jDrnfdGvXGAFpfpB534Gt5S7
transaction
e9081d9b64e000730b81dbebcaa40ee89f0cfeb7500992055d1102542f071b32
confirmations
421606
spent
true